I love older buildings. I live in one now, and despite the single
circuit electricity that shorts-out on a regular basis, the lack of
insulation, and other aspects of its “charm,” the place has tales to
tell. And I’m a sucker for stories. Who lived there before me? What were
their lives like? Whose idea was it to paint the living room baby
diarrhea green? But my limited imagination only goes back a hundred or
so years, when the apartment was first built. In Here, groundbreaking
graphic novelist Richard McGuire takes it much, much!
further—visualizing the goings-on in a specific corner of a specific
room over the course of hundreds of thousands of years (past, present,
and future). The result is an orgy of the ordinary that is slyly clever
and unexpectedly moving. McGuire first conceived of Here in 1989. It was
a six-page comic whose influence ended up being as enduring as the room
in which it is set. So, the arrival of this expanded edition is cause
for much celebration in graphic novel circles, and as it turns out, in
mine as well. I don’t typically read graphic novels, but Here is
anything but typical. And, when I sit in my little corner of the world,
I’m envisioning the future for a change—all the book-loving brethren who
will inhabit that space after me, who I hope will discover and delight
